Job Description
Take the next step in your career by joining the team that supports External reporting, Balance sheet, & Risk Weighted Assets review.
As an External Reporting Controller Associate within our Finance organization, you will be responsible for the timely and accurate regulatory submissions for the Line of Business. You will also be responsible for monitoring balance sheet, capital, Risk Weighted Assets review (RWA)/forecast.
Job Responsibilities

  • Oversee and be accountable for the quality of the Regulatory Reporting disclosures of the Business
  • Interact with product controllers teams, coordinate effort and consolidate information required for Regulatory disclosures
  • Review RWA for different risk stripes in Credit and Market risk.
  • Provide guidance on accounting for products, liaising with Accounting Policy group where appropriate and ensuring compliance with Corporate Regulatory requirements
  • Provide analytical support for optimizing balance sheet and capital usage for the lines of businesses
  • Monitor the LOBs Balance Sheet from a net funding usage and from Basel 3 liquidity ratios perspective
  • Collect external disclosures from regional product controllers; consolidating data, performing consistency checks for analytical review.
  • Work with the business to ensure that they fully understand developments in Regulatory framework and priorities, i.e. changes to the Capital framework, the impact of Risk Weighted Assets, revenue recognition on new deals.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
